Itinerary highlights
Begin in Copenhagen with a 2-night stay at Copenhagen Island. Located on an artificial island by the harbour, this hotel features ultra-modern design. Delve into the city's cafe culture, which is linked to Denmark's concept of hygge (cosy comfort and togetherness). Wander along the harbour, and visit Tivoli Gardens—it's a 10-minute train ride from the hotel.
Next, board an overnight ferry to Oslo. You'll sail in a bunk bed cabin. Arrive the next morning and make your way to your hotel for the next two nights. Oslo is extremely easy to explore by tram. You'll be a 20-minute tram journey from the Munch museum (dedicated to Edvard Munch's artworks) and the Oslo Opera House (famous for it's Instagram-worthy rooftop views—you don't need a ticket to visit).
This deal includes tickets to the Fram Museum, Oslo's polar exploration museum. The museum is a 20-minute taxi ride from the hotel**.
You'll then fly to Stockholm for your final 3-night stay. Hotel Gio, BW Signature Collection, is five minutes' taxi ride from Haga Park, an English-style park with walking trails. You'll be a 15-minute train journey from central Stockholm, where you'll find Gamla Stan (the old town). Be sure to visit the Vasa Museum, a maritime museum with the only preserved 17th-century ship in the world.
Stockholm is spread across 14 islands, making it the largest archipelago in Sweden. You'll join an archipelago tour during your stay.
